Eaton purchased the Westinghouse Distribution and Control Business Unit in 1994, acquiring the Numa-Logic PLC line as
part of the acquisition. Eaton sold the Numa-Logic PLCs (along with the Accutrol and Vectrol products) to
Advanced Technology Services. Many of the original engineers and
experts are still around (albeit at different companies).
If you have a question about old Numa-Logic NL-300 (card logic), PC-400
(bubble memory PLC),
NL-500 (2-wire remote I/O system), PC-700 (bit slice PLC), PC-900, PC1100
(Z-80 based PLC), PC1200 (80188 PLC),
PC1250, HPPC1500
(bit slice CPU w/integral PS), HPPC1700 (bit slice CPU with separate PS) or the Westnet II Data Highway (2 Mbbs token passing
network with guaranteed 0.1 s updates), perhaps we can help to direct you to the right source. Send a request to
